    Default indian town creek


    this is a late report but haveing problems with new computer so their will be no pictures. i fished a half day from sunrise till noon. found the good bream in 6 ft of water on points useing bettle spins, yellow was the best. i had a blast catching bream the whole time i was there. no slabs but many up tp 3/4 lb. well i'm like george it's back to the city lake for some crappie action. tite lines JIM.B

    have you ever fished i/t before? i launch at the old bridge on i/t creek. i caught my fish on the left shoreland past the island starting at the first bend heading down river. i think they were on the beds. when you catch your first fish there will be more. this is for anybody who may want to give it a try. tite lines JIM.B

    For those of you that are not familiar with the area Jim was actually fishing in North River. North River starts at the mouths of Indian Town Creek, Frog Creek and East Canal. Since the ramp is on Indian Town Creek that's where we say we are going. So much for today's geography lesson.
